  • Publication number: 20250213068
    Abstract: An outdoor cooking station configured to simultaneously and independently cook food with separate cooking modes. The cooking station includes a main body extending to define a smoker chamber and a separate air fryer chamber. The smoker chamber is heated with smoke from igniting and burning pellets and the air fryer chamber is heated with an electrical heating element and a fan for mixing the air therein. In one embodiment, the cooking station includes a motor fan that draws smoke from the smoker chamber to the air fryer chamber with ducting therebetween. With this arrangement, the cooking station provides different cooking chambers dedicated for cooking food independent of each other as well as a secondary chamber or the air fryer chamber being employed for cold smoking food items or the option to provide smoke to the air fryer chamber while air frying the food therein.

  • Publication number: 20240415329
    Abstract: A cooking system for managing food byproduct, the cooking system including a main body, a griddle, and a drawer. The main body includes structure to support the griddle positioned above a heat element. The griddle includes a cooking surface with an opening defined in the griddle, the opening positioned adjacent a rear end of the cooking surface. The drawer includes a grease container, the drawer being moveable between an inserted position and a removed position. In the inserted position, the grease container is positioned below the opening of the griddle and adjacent a rear side of the main body with a front portion of the drawer accessible along a front side of the main body. With this arrangement, the drawer is removable from the front side of the main body and captures food byproduct in the grease container adjacent the rear side of the main body.

  • Patent number: 12091916
    Abstract: A ladder may include a first pair of spaced apart members, a second pair of spaced apart members and a first pair of hinges coupling the first pair of spaced apart members with the second pair of spaced apart members. In some embodiments, each hinge may include a first hinge component including at least a first hinge plate, the first hinge plate having a notch formed therein, the notch including a first abutment wall and a second abutment wall, a second hinge component including at least a second hinge plate, and a lock mechanism having a pivot pin and a lock pin. The lock mechanism is configured for selective engagement with the notch such that the pivot pin engages the first abutment wall and the lock pin engages the second abutment wall to lock the first hinge component relative to the second hinge component in a first hinge position.
